Proper tooling of v-joint helps to prevent water accumulation and the penetration into the … WebJun 27, 2024 · How to remove mortar from brick: Grind out the joints Photo 1: Grind the horizontal joints first Grind along the top and bottom of the horizontal joints to remove mortar. Get as close to the bricks as you can. If you grind against the bricks, the dust will turn the color of the brick. Photo 2: Plunge-cut the vertical joints
